Базы данныхИнтернетКомпьютерыОперационные системыПрограммированиеСетиСвязьРазное
Поиск по сайту:
Подпишись на рассылку:

Назад в раздел

MS Word,который не "слово"

div.main {margin-left: 20pt; margin-right: 20pt}

MS Word,который не "слово"

Вначале было слово, как известно из самой, что ни на есть, классической книги. И наверняка это так. Может, люди и мыслят образами, но в подавляющем своем большинстве они общаются между собой с помощью слов. Их произносят. Их пишут. Собственно, еще до недавнего времени, практически вся информация состояла исключительно из слов. Между прочим, развитие цивилизации в целом началось лишь только тогда, когда люди научились записывать слова и тем самым сохранять их для потомков.

В настоящее время значение слов не только не уменьшилось, но даже значительно возросло. Письма. Контракты. Справки. Да чего только не приходится составлять изо дня в день. Даже специальность такая интересная появилась - секретарь-машинистка. Т.е. женщина, которая умеет быстро барабанить по клавишам и делать не слишком много ошибок. Сейчас на смену шумным "пишмашкам" пришли молчаливые и загадочные "персоналки", и жизнь стала значительно легче. Во всяком случае - теоретически. Словом, что бы там ни говорили представители немногочисленных ведущих программистских компаний, выпускающих текстовые процессоры, про "выдающиеся возможности" и "революционные качества", а в своем подавляющем большинстве столь красочно расписанные достоинства больше похожи на многоопытного джина , который все может, но, на каком языке с ним общаться, никто толком не ведает. Вот и выходит, что из всего богатства выбора всевозможных сервисов пользователи применяют не более полутора десятков простых команд. И очень даже зря, ибо не даром все эти хитрости придумывались.

Вот мы и решили внести свой посильный вклад в святое дело просвещения мирового человечества. Вы не находите странным, что подавляющее большинство офисов и частных лиц применяют редактор Word фирмы Microsoft, а ни одной приличной книжки на тему "сделай сам" днем с огнем не сыскать? Те, кто хоть что-нибудь понял, полагают свои навыки совершенно естественными и не считают нужным ими делиться, а те, кто не совсем сию премудрость освоил, особо "в глубь" не забираются, ибо им работать надо, а учиться некогда. В то же время, книжные полки ломятся от многочисленной литературы "на заданную тему", являющейся, по сути, русифицированным и малость облагороженным фирменным руководством пользователя, в котором, несомненно, есть абсолютно все, но пока это "все" там найдешь - козленочком станешь. В общем, мы решили так: кой-чего мы в "ворде" понимаем и попробуем рассказать об этом "по-простому". Только есть одна просьба - присылайте в редакцию вопросы и пожелания, что конкретно у вас не получается и что именно вам (или вашему начальству) хочется в MS Word сотворить.

Ну да ладно, перейдем, как говориться, к делу. По собственному опыту могу сказать, что большинство проблем у пользователей, особенно испорченных пишущими машинками и самыми первыми, до безумия примитивными, текстовыми редакторами (типа CeWriter), возникает от полного непонимания устройства самого MS Word и логики, лежащей в основе его функционирования. Вот с этого и начнем.

Когда в обычной жизни человек берется что-нибудь записать, он просто берет ручку, берет бумагу и начинает заполнять свободное место. При этом он обязан сразу помнить про правописание, всякие отступы с интервалами и красную строку. Иначе нельзя, ибо малейшая ошибка грозит напрочь испортить всю работу. Именно поэтому MS Word изначально научили думать иначе.

Текстовый редактор фирмы Microsoft свято верит, что первоосновой всего сущего являются размеры листа бумаги, на котором предстоит писать. В меню ФАЙЛ есть режим ПАРАМЕТРЫ СТРАНИЦЫ... как раз за данный вопрос и отвечающий. Все гениально и, поэтому, просто. Абсолютно все манипуляции программа производит исходя из неизменных границ листа, заданного, например, в сантиметрах или, согласно требованиям советского ГОСТа, шифром формата (по умолчанию - А4). Перво-наперво проверяется расположение прямоугольного листа в пространстве. По умолчанию, подразумевается, что он ориентирован узкой стороной вниз, что называется "портретная", к чему мы и привыкли. Однако в некоторых случаях, особенно в случае печати широких таблиц и картинок, имеет смысл развернуть лист боком, что достигается переключением режима ориентации на "альбомную".

Дальше просто. Любое форматирование текста начинается с того, что определяется величина отступа текста от физических краев бумажного листа. Естественно, программа имеет в данном случае установки "по умолчанию", но, на мой взгляд, их имеет смысл слегка подкорректировать и отступ слева слегка увеличить, но это уже личное дело каждого. Словом, MS Word берет лист, отступает от края и получает внутри свободный прямоугольник, куда непосредственно и производится набор информации. Я специально не говорю "текста" потому, что за отведенные границы не позволяется выйти никому. Ни тексту, ни таблице.

Вторым основополагающим моментом функционирования текстового редактора является четкое разбиение зоны ввода на три обособленные части: верхний колонтитул, непосредственно текст и нижний колонтитул. Колонтитул - это то, что печатается неизменным на каждой странице. Например, ее порядковый номер или имя автора. На самом деле такое положение дел имеет большой смысл. Вспомните, сколько раз вы искали только что отпечатанный текст только потому, что не запомнили - куда сохранили? Так вот, в меню ВИД есть команда КОЛОНТИТУЛЫ, с помощью которой ими и управляют. В данном случае я рассказываю о версии MS Word 97, но имеющиеся отличия от привычного "ворда для win95" незначительны, так что ими можно пренебречь.

Колонтитулы, вообще-то, являются обычным текстом, на который распространяются общие правила форматирования. Помимо всего прочего, тут можно применять элементы автоматического текста, например "Страница № из №№", что, согласитесь, гораздо удобнее, чем проставлять нумерацию вручную и постоянно ее проверять после любой правки текста в любом его месте.

Теперь можно переходить и к самому документу. С точки зрения MS Word все, что считается документом, является последовательным набором абзацев, которые заканчиваются символом конца абзаца. Смысл в таком представлении следующий. В старых текстовых редакторах, как и в пишущих машинках, выравнивание слов на границе документа было тяжелейшей обязанностью оператора (машинистки). Любая ошибка правилась подставлением лишних пробелов в строку текста между имеющимися словами, что всегда отнимало уйму времени. Но другого выхода не было, ибо вся строка представлялась набором "посадочных мест" для любых символов, а какие они - информационные, служебные или управляющие - роли не играло. Естественно, стоило поменять шрифт при печати и все опять шло насмарку. Теперь же, процессор понимает, что если (при заданном размере и типе шрифта) последнее слово выбивается за границу области, отведенной для текста, его следует перенести на следующую строку, что и делается автоматически. Таким образом, уже можно не отвлекаться по пустякам и просто нажимать "ВВОД", как только доберетесь до конца абзаца, а потом продолжать дальше.

После того, как ввод текста закончен, самое время придать ему благородно-законченный вид. Исключительно для этого существует меню ФОРМАТ. По-моему, это самое важно меню из всех имеющихся. В общем, если есть документ, то его надо выделить (весь или частично), после чего из меню ФОРМАТ выбрать команду АБЗАЦ и указать, каким образом абзацы должны выглядеть.

Сам по себе абзац является таким же объектом, как и весь бумажный лист. Это означает, что можно назначить дополнительные отступы слева и справа, но они отсчитываются не от края бумаги, а от границы того прямоугольника, внутрь которого вводится текст. Также допускается принудительно указать величину отступа абзаца сверху и снизу, они определяют ширину пробела под и над выделенным абзацем.

Прежде всего определяется тип выравнивания символов. Обычно, в деловой документации применяется выравнивание по обоим краям, что значительно улучшает внешний вид страницы вцелом. Тогда текстовый редактор добавит пробелы таким образом, чтобы первая и последняя позиция строки были заняты текстовыми символами. Однако, в зависимости от ситуации, выравнивать допускается по любому из краев или по центру. В этих случаях дополнительные пробелы не вставляются.

Потом указывается тип первой строки абзаца. Это может быть Отступ (красная строка) или Выступ, и величину этого отличия также можно задать вручную, если стандартное не утраивает по каким-либо причинам. И величину междустрочного расстояния. Опять же если типовое не устраивает. Я, например, выставил "по умолчанию" полуторный интервал. На экране его, естественно, практически не заметно, но при печати это позволяет править текст на бумаге без потери четкости восприятия напечатанного.

В результате получился документ, который и в руки взять не стыдно. Правда, способ, которым он получен, даже я не считаю оптимальным. Дело в том, что MS Word имеет массу других возможностей, приводящих к тому же результату, но проще и быстрее. Однако, чтобы понять, как эти способы работают, и было необходимо пройтись по азам собственными пальчиками. Ибо иного пути пока еще не придумано.

В следующий раз мы поговорим об использовании стилей для ускоренного форматирования документов.

Александр Запольскис
E-mail: leshy@nestor.minsk.by


  • Главная
  • Новости
  • Новинки
  • Скрипты
  • Форум
  • Ссылки
  • О сайте




  • Emanual.ru – это сайт, посвящённый всем значимым событиям в IT-индустрии: новейшие разработки, уникальные методы и горячие новости! Тонны информации, полезной как для обычных пользователей, так и для самых продвинутых программистов! Интересные обсуждения на актуальные темы и огромная аудитория, которая может быть интересна широкому кругу рекламодателей. У нас вы узнаете всё о компьютерах, базах данных, операционных системах, сетях, инфраструктурах, связях и программированию на популярных языках!
     Copyright © 2001-2024
    Реклама на сайте